IREN typically reports earnings after market close, meaning Day 0 captures anticipatory trading before results are released, while Day +1 reflects the market's first full session to digest the actual numbers.
| Earnings Date | Day 0 Move | Day 0 Range | Day +1 Move | Day +1 Range |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2026-05-07 | -$4.13 (-6.77%) | $7.02 (11.51%) | +$4.35 (+7.65%) | $7.70 (13.54%) |
| 2026-02-05 | -$5.15 (-11.46%) | $6.02 (13.40%) | +$2.04 (+5.13%) | $7.70 (19.35%) |
| 2025-11-06 | -$9.45 (-12.37%) | $9.12 (11.94%) | -$4.58 (-6.84%) | $7.33 (10.95%) |
| 2025-08-28 | +$0.68 (+3.06%) | $1.66 (7.43%) | +$3.44 (+14.93%) | $3.88 (16.84%) |
| 2025-05-14 | -$0.15 (-1.85%) | $0.32 (3.98%) | -$0.22 (-2.76%) | $0.44 (5.52%) |
| 2025-02-12 | +$0.59 (+4.75%) | $1.20 (9.66%) | +$0.07 (+0.54%) | $1.02 (7.84%) |
| 2024-11-26 | -$0.85 (-8.17%) | $0.86 (8.21%) | +$2.84 (+29.71%) | $2.09 (21.86%) |
| 2024-05-15 |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A |
| Avg Abs Move | 6.92% | 9.45% | 9.65% | 13.70% |
IREN's post-earnings price action has been volatile and unpredictable, with moves frequently exceeding 10% in either direction. The most recent report in May 2026 saw the stock drop 6.77% on Day 0, followed by a sharp 7.65% rebound on Day +1. February 2026 was even more dramatic: an 11.46% Day 0 decline, then a 5.13% Day +1 recovery. The November 2025 report triggered a brutal 12.37% Day 0 selloff and continued weakness with a 6.84% Day +1 decline.
Historically, IREN averages an absolute Day 0 move of 6.92% and a Day +1 move of 9.65%, with Day +1 ranges averaging 13.70%—indicating significant intraday volatility as the market digests results. The pattern suggests initial reactions are often reversed or amplified the following session, making timing particularly treacherous. The options market is pricing an expected move of 9.28% through Friday's expiration, slightly above the historical Day 0 average of 6.92% but below the Day +1 average of 9.65%. This suggests options traders are anticipating volatility in line with recent history, though the 13.70% average Day +1 range indicates potential for even wider swings than currently priced.
Analyst sentiment on IREN remains bullish on paper but increasingly uncertain in practice. The consensus rating stands at 4.33 out of 5.0 (between Buy and Strong Buy), with 11 Strong Buys, 3 Holds, and 1 Strong Sell among 15 analysts covering the stock. The mean price target of $78.64 implies 99% upside from the current $39.58 price, with estimates ranging from a low of $46.00 to a high of $105.00.
However, sentiment has remained unchanged over the past month according to the precomputed trend indicator, even as the stock has declined and earnings estimates have deteriorated. This disconnect suggests analysts are maintaining long-term conviction in IREN's strategic pivot toward AI infrastructure while acknowledging near-term execution challenges.
The wide dispersion in price targets—from $46.00 to $105.00—reflects deep disagreement about the company's path to profitability. Bulls see the AI data center opportunity as transformative, potentially justifying the $105.00 high target. Bears, represented by the single Strong Sell rating and $46.00 low target (just 16% upside), question whether IREN can achieve sustainable profitability in either bitcoin mining or AI infrastructure given current cost structures and competitive dynamics. The $78.64 consensus target implies the Street is giving IREN the benefit of the doubt—but four consecutive earnings misses have tested that patience.

With the stock below every meaningful moving average and technical signals uniformly bearish, IREN faces earnings from a position of technical weakness. The 200-day moving average at $46.17 represents overhead resistance 17% above current levels, while the recent low of $28.93 in July provides support 27% below. The technical setup is decidedly cautionary—any disappointment on earnings could trigger another leg down, while a positive surprise would need to be substantial to reverse the entrenched bearish momentum and reclaim key moving averages.
